Question Tire life while in storage

Anyone know how long would "tires" on the wheels w/air in em would last? They were stored maybe 2 years stacked on their sides in a climate controlled storage room. Would the tires still be safe to use?

they are just OEM ones, I was thinking of putting back them back on, when I either sell or trade the car.

Or just maybe have a tire shop check em out? Just curious for the most part as I'll probably be too lazy to part out anyway (lmgts look so outdated nowdays)

Tires are usually good for 5 years, so depending on how old they were before they were put in storage, they should be okay
